Output 2081dde0ef75fb63be964f4e45e5b094e4a8f3bd0218920f0728dcbfb2dccc79:1

value
443686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024eb45863661aef2fe4b9d7445d18c00a470672 OP_EQUAL
address
31uDZQjtEfTtvc4QvQy4mxnUnkW6kowbuV
transaction
2081dde0ef75fb63be964f4e45e5b094e4a8f3bd0218920f0728dcbfb2dccc79
confirmations
265852
spent
true